E69 - Jeff Arnold: Insurance Monopoly; The Art of Buying a Selling Agencies

Jeff Arnold is the President of RightSure Insurance Group and the author of the book The Art of The Insurance Deal. Jeff spoke with Tony and me about how he locates, finances and buys insurance agencies. We discussed things that can blow up a deal, how sometimes, purchased agencies do not end up being a good fit and in some cases, those same agencies need to be sold to other buyers that can make them a good fit.  Some important considerations when buying an agency are: - is it a good fit?- how should the agency be valued?- how should the price be financed?- what are the responsibilities of the sellers upon the sale?- how do you integrate the newly acquired staff and IT?
